- Silver VittrupApr 11, 2023 · 2 years agoWarrants and other investment options in the world of digital currencies differ in several key aspects. Firstly, warrants are financial instruments that give the holder the right, but not the obligation, to buy or sell a specific amount of a digital currency at a predetermined price and within a specific time frame. This provides investors with the opportunity to profit from the price movements of the underlying digital currency without actually owning it. On the other hand, other investment options such as buying and holding digital currencies or trading on exchanges involve direct ownership or trading of the actual digital currency. Secondly, warrants often have leverage, meaning that the potential gains or losses from a warrant investment can be magnified compared to the price movements of the underlying digital currency. This can provide investors with the opportunity for higher returns, but also increases the risk involved. Lastly, warrants are typically offered by financial institutions or exchanges, while other investment options in the digital currency world can be accessed through various platforms and services. Overall, warrants offer a unique way to gain exposure to digital currencies without directly owning them, but investors should carefully consider the risks and benefits before engaging in warrant investments.
